- The distance between Hun, Libya and Bahawalnagar, Pakistan is approximately 5,485 km or 3,408 mi.
- To reach Hun in this distance one would set out from Bahawalnagar bearing 284.2°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hun bearing 254.1° or WSW .
- Both have a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Hun is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Bahawalnagar is in or near the tropical thorn woodland bi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 4.8 °C (8.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.3 °C (7.7°F) less in Hun.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 167.9 mm (6.6 in) less which is equivalent to 167.9 l/m² (4.12 US gal/ft²) or 1,679,000 l/ha (179,496 US gal/ac) less. About 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.8° higher in Hun than in Bahawalnagar.
